This is a site for angling. Camping Fayón Fishing is a leafy spot in peaceful Zaragoza countryside between two fish-laden rivers, and a short drive from the equally fish-filled and famed reservoirs of Ribarroja and Mequinenza. Angling is the principal sporting pursuit around the locale, with the scenic Matarraña and Ebro rivers both flowing around half an hour’s walk away. All you might need for weeks of fishing is on hand at the site’s tackle shop, where anglers can pick up licences, boat rentals, electric motors, probes, trailers, bait and the advice of expert local fishermen. Away from the water, Camping Fayón Fishing is in a region crossed by many a major hiking and cycling route: head to reception to pick up handy local tourist info and to talk to the team about their fave spots. Keeping entertained on site is a cinch too, with gardens to laze around, a playground, a TV room, pétanque, football, basketball and tennis are also around for the active. The restaurant dishes up helpings of local eats at lunch or dinnertime; next to it is the site’s bar and terrace, which overlook the site gardens as well as the municipal pools adjacent to the site and 30 metres away. Close by, the site's within easy walking distance of the local village tavernas for plenty more dining options, or for self-catering supplies from local grocery stores.

Local attractions

Plenty of biking and hiking routes are around Fayón, several of which provide spectacular views over the Ebro and Matarraña rivers: wildlife watching is an excellent option here too, so do remain eagle-eyed on your travels. The proximity of the site to its local rivers of Matarraña and Ebro plus the Ribarroja and Mequinenza reservoirs (both a short drive away), makes it a top spot to head to for the sport fishing of species such as catfish, pike-perch, bass and carp – as well as the elusive and enormous Wels catfish. At the site’s local town of Fayón, the museum is a tiptop spot at which to delve into local history. Telling the story of the Battle of the Ebro – the Spanish Civil War’s longest and biggest battle – the museum circuit takes visitors through a large hall of exhibits, past scenes from the battle and among huge standalone artillery objects as well as collections of rifles, shells and other artefacts.
